This practice is outlined in the "Tall fescue for fall and winter" section.Fescue will withstand closer grazing and more abuse than most cool-season grasses. But it can be overgrazed to the point that vigor as well as production is reduced. Don't graze closer than 3 or 4 inches and allow at least 30 days for the fescue to recover.Mowing Height. Maintain cutting height of 2.5 to 3"; taller to 3 to 3.5" in warm summer months. Tall fescue is a rapid grower during cool weather and mowing needs are on 5 to 7 day intervals (less frequent in warm months). Mow no more than 1/3 of the leaf off at one mowing. Both fine fescue and tall fescue are cool-weather grasses and therefore do not prefer direct sunlight. The ideal temperature for tall fescue is between 50°F and 85°F. When the temperature falls below 50°F or goes above 85°F, the grass will go dormant. In contrast, tall fescue still thrives even under periods of heavy rain.Seedheads can contain five times more ergovaline (toxin in tall fescue) than leaf blades (Figure 4). Clipping seedheads in tall fescue pastures not only maintains forage quality, but also decrease ergovaline levels. Seedheads can also be controlled by plant growth regulators. Tall fescue needs a weekly application of about 1 to 1¼ inches of water, which will wet the soil to a depth of 4 to 6 inches. Sandy soils often require more frequent watering, such as ¾ inch every three days. Weed Control: Apply broadleaf herbicides to control dandelions, wild onions, cudweed, and other weeds if necessary.
